## Changelog — Ticktrace 1.9

### Renamed: DRIFT_API_TOKEN
During the cron drift investigation we found plugins confusing this variable with the metrics token, so it has been renamed to indicate it authorizes drift-report uploads specifically. Plugin authors must read the new name from 1.9 onward; the old name is ignored without warning. Sample env files in the SDK are updated. In your deployment env file, the drift-report upload secret is set on the next line.

env line for fawef-taguf: VAULT_KEY13=a9695905a9a90

Action item from the Quillmark proctoring outage: the exam-proctoring queue must alert when depth exceeds 500 items for more than five minutes, since silent backlog growth delayed exam starts for two hours. Future maintainers should verify the alert threshold after each capacity change and record the rationale. The queue sizing worksheet and alert configuration steps live on the page below.

operations page: https://jenkins.zemvarcloud.local/job/merge_requests/repo/build/73930b4b30f0a8ed

**Account recovery — Lockerly laundry-locker flow.** If a resident loses locker access, verify identity via the Brimhall kiosk, then trigger a recovery token from the ops console. Tokens expire in 10 minutes. If the kiosk is offline, fall back to manual vault unlock on the Lockerly admin node. Manual unlock prompts twice; second prompt is the escrow challenge. Enter the passphrase below exactly as written.

unlock words, hahip-baduf: holwyn-istath-julvan

## Runbook: FareWise pricing experiment rollback

If the FareWise experiment produces anomalous price deltas, disable the experiment flag first, then flush the pricing cache. Do not redeploy until the variant assignments are confirmed frozen, or historical analysis will be contaminated. Record the rollback time in the experiment log, along with the active build token noted below.

build token for tawip-yageg: htk9_92ac43d42